Online Marketing vs. Traditional Marketing: What’s the Difference?

What’s the difference between online marketing and traditional marketing? Traditional marketing refers to advertising through television, radio, billboards, and print media, while online marketing refers to advertising through digital channels like social media, search engines, email, and websites. Online marketing is more precise in targeting and measurement, allowing businesses to track engagement and conversion rates in real-time. In contrast, traditional marketing relies on less precise targeting methods and more generalized metrics like viewership or circulation. Online marketing also allows for more interactivity and engagement with customers through social media, enabling businesses to build communities, respond to feedback, and provide personalized experiences

The Debate Between Display Ads and Native Ads: Which One Wins?

When it comes to online advertising, display ads and native ads are two of the most popular options available. While display ads are the traditional banner ads that we see on websites, native ads are designed to blend in with the website’s content seamlessly. The benefit of display ads is that they can reach a large audience, while native ads are better at engaging users and generating clicks. However, display ads can be intrusive and annoying to users, whereas native ads can be expensive to create. Ultimately, whether you choose display ads or native ads will depend on your marketing goals and budget. So, carefully consider your options and choose the type of ad that will help you reach your desired audience.
